Search in: Word
Vietnamese keyboard: Off
Virtual keyboard: Show
English - English (Wordnet) dictionary
pennine chain
Jump to user comments
Noun
  • a system of hills in Britain that extend from the Scottish border in the north to the Trent River in the south; forms the watershed for English rivers
Related words
Related search result for "pennine chain"
Comments and discussion on the word "pennine chain"